This gorgeous village can claim one of the prettiest riverbank settings in the Scottish Borders, with views across the River Tweed to Melrose and the historic Eildon Hills.
Stable Lodge sits in the corner position of a quiet stable courtyard behind historic Hoebridge House. The property has been renovated to a high standard to provide larger, more spacious rooms than you would expect in a typical two bedroom house, or holiday cottage.
The lodge is tastefully decorated. Period panelling and antiques are mixed with comfortable furnishings and contemporary work from award winning local artists.
Upstairs there are two bedrooms which sleep five in comfort, making this the ideal home away from home for families, couples or a small group of friends. Bedroom 1 has a kingsize bed. Bedroom two has a double bed and a single day bed. There is a toilet on the upstairs landing. The main luxury shower room and further toilet facilities are off the spacious ground floor hallway.
Downstairs the main living space is excellent. The open plan design makes this a sociable space to enjoy holiday time, whether you’re planning a family break or a catch up with your friends. The main panelled living room has a feature cast iron stove and Smart TV for those cosy nights in. There are two leather club style sofas, an armchair and a bay window seat with views to neighbouring garden areas.
An open archway connects directly with the kitchen and dining room area, where you will find all you need to prepare and enjoy those special meals. The kitchen is well equipped with modern appliances, including integrated dishwasher, a fridge freezer and a washing machine. It boasts a good selection of quality equipment, all you need to prepare great meals to enjoy round the spacious dining table.
The cottage makes a perfect base for fishing and golf, hiking and biking in the Borders hills or for gentler riverside strolls. It is a 15 minute walk into Melrose across a listed footbridge over the River Tweed.
Melrose is famed for its abbey and Rugby’s Sevens Tournament, the Borders Book festival and nearby Abbotsford House, home to Sir Walter Scott.
Melrose offers a range of local shops with bars, cafés and restaurants on a busy high street. Gattonside itself has two highly rated restaurants, both within two minutes walk of Stable Lodge. The nearby train station at Tweedbank also gives easy access to Edinburgh for a day out using the scenic Border Rail Line.
